Magnetic resonance T2 mapping and diffusion-weighted imaging for early detection of cystogenesis and response to therapy in a mouse model of polycystic kidney disease.
Kidney international - 1 Dec 2017
Franke Mareike, Baeßler Bettina, Vechtel Jan, Dafinger Claudia, Höhne Martin, Borgal Lori, Göbel Heike, Koerber Friederike, Maintz David, Benzing Thomas, Schermer Bernhard, Persigehl Thorsten
Abstract excerpt
Polycystic kidney disease (PKD) is among the leading causes of end-stage renal disease. Increasing evidence exists that molecular therapeutic strategies targeted to cyst formation and growth might be more efficacious in early disease stages, highlighting the growing need for sensitive biomarkers.
